Crosstalk? Crosstalk is an electrical engineering term relating to the leakage of information from one channel to another, individual to individual, the murmur of discontent, and the whisper in the street. The communication, and quality of this information, is of prime importance in achieving positive change for our future. A future which aims to try and keep everybody happy.
